Transaction 26e5071d9539918fd95481609951c769766b71937af1d34d3334dab81c139196

1 Input
2 Outputs
  • 26e5071d9539918fd95481609951c769766b71937af1d34d3334dab81c139196:0
  • value  2000000
    address  1JHU6Qm6Ty1FDgpye63E5Qa9TAqdjv2srT
  • 26e5071d9539918fd95481609951c769766b71937af1d34d3334dab81c139196:1
  • value  146967000
    address  1BaWNoFCLk2Z8BRdYRYQ5CoAmHZbbkDv6w